Dr. Kuldeep Kumar Tiwari
- About Faculty: Dr. Kuldeep Kumar Tiwari is working as an Assistant Professor at Department of Mathematics and Computing, Madhav Institute of Technology and Science - Deemed University, Gwalior, Madhya Pradesh. He has a Ph.D. in Mathematics from Shri Mata Vaishno Devi University, Jammu. His research focuses on Sampling Theory and he has published widely in high-impact journals and presented at international conferences. Actively mentoring students, he has guided numerous undergraduate and postgraduate projects. Dr. Tiwari serves as a reviewer for prominent journals and participates in faculty development, underscoring his dedication to academic excellence and societal growth.
